在当前网页设计日益追求动态交互与视觉冲击力的趋势下,用户对页面的流畅性、响应速度和沉浸感提出了更高要求。传统的静态页面虽然结构清晰,但在信息传达和情感共鸣方面已显乏力。而SVG滚动动画设计凭借其轻量级、可缩放、支持渐进式加载等特性,正在成为现代网页设计中不可或缺的技术手段。尤其在品牌展示、产品介绍和用户引导场景中,恰当运用SVG滚动动画不仅能增强视觉层次感,还能有效延长用户的停留时间,提升整体转化率。
理解核心概念:视口触发与动画协同机制
要实现流畅且精准的滚动动画,首先需要掌握几个关键技术概念。其中,“视口触发”(viewport trigger)是基础逻辑——即当元素进入浏览器可视区域时,才开始执行动画。这避免了页面加载初期大量动画资源被提前渲染,从而减轻性能负担。配合CSS中的transform属性与animation或keyframes,可以实现平滑的位移、旋转、缩放等效果。例如,通过translateY(100px)结合opacity变化,可以让一个图标从底部缓缓浮现,营造出自然的进入感。这种组合方式不仅代码简洁,而且性能表现优异,特别适合移动端环境。

主流实践中的常见问题与性能瓶颈
目前许多网站在应用SVG滚动动画时,仍存在一些典型问题。比如,在品牌介绍页中堆叠多个动态图标序列,或在产品模块中采用一次性加载所有动画路径的方式,导致首屏加载缓慢甚至出现卡顿现象。此外,部分开发者未对SVG文件进行优化,保留了大量冗余路径、无用注释或重复节点,使得文件体积过大,影响解析效率。更严重的是,若依赖JavaScript频繁监听scroll事件,容易引发性能抖动,尤其是在低端设备上表现尤为明显。
优化策略:从懒加载到精准触发的升级路径
为解决上述问题,必须引入系统化的优化方案。首先是“懒加载”机制的应用,将非关键动画延迟至用户滚动至相关区域后再加载,确保首屏快速呈现。其次是主动优化SVG代码结构——使用工具如SVGO清理不必要的元数据、合并路径、压缩坐标点,使文件体积减少30%以上。更重要的是,借助现代浏览器原生支持的Intersection Observer API,实现对元素可见性的高效监测。相比传统scroll监听,该方法仅在目标元素进入视口时触发一次回调,极大降低了计算开销,同时保证了动画触发的准确性。
创新方向:基于用户行为的个性化动效反馈
除了技术层面的优化,更具前瞻性的思路在于将动画与用户行为数据联动。例如,通过记录用户在某个模块的停留时间,动态调整动画细节:停留时间较短则展示简化版动效,停留超过5秒后逐步解锁更丰富的过渡细节。这种“智能响应”机制不仅提升了体验的个性化程度,也增强了用户的参与感与沉浸感。它让动画不再是单向的视觉表演,而是真正服务于用户体验的交互工具。蓝橙广告在多个项目中已成功实践此类策略,帮助客户实现了平均停留时长提升40%以上的显著成果。
综上所述,SVG滚动动画设计已从简单的视觉装饰演变为一种兼具美学价值与商业效能的重要技术手段。合理运用视口触发、代码优化与行为联动等策略,不仅能显著提升页面视觉表现力,还能有效降低跳出率,推动转化效率增长。在数字体验竞争愈发激烈的今天,每一次流畅的动效都可能成为留住用户的关键一击。蓝橙广告专注于数字创意领域多年,始终致力于探索前沿技术在实际项目中的落地应用,我们以扎实的技术能力与敏锐的用户洞察,助力品牌打造更具吸引力与转化力的网页体验,如果您有相关的项目需求欢迎直接联系17723342546


